Vast has introduced an innovative Astronaut Flight Suit designed for its upcoming Haven-1 space station, emphasizing functionality and comfort for crews, while also unveiling a Large Docking Adapter that significantly enhances spacecraft connectivity in orbit, aiming to address limitations of current systems. The company is positioning itself to lead in the evolution of commercial space stations and aims to open-source the docking technology for broader industry adoption.
Vast's introduction of the Large Docking Adapter, with a significantly larger pressurized opening and enhanced structural capabilities, presents a potential game-changer for future space station architecture. This open-sourced docking standard could become the industry norm, facilitating the assembly of expansive orbital habitats and enabling the integration of larger modules that may support artificial gravity environments. The strategic move to open-source this technology invites adoption across the space industry, positioning Vast as a pivotal player in the transition to commercially operated space stations.
